Getting There

  • Car

    If you are driving, take Route 138 towards Yamanakako. From the Mount Fuji area, follow the signs for Yamanakako and continue on Route 138 for approximately 20 minutes. Look for signs for Hana-no-miyako Park Furara as you approach Yamanakako. The park is located at 〒401-0501 Yamanashi, Minamitsuru District, Yamanakako, Yamanaka, 1650. There is parking available at the park, but please note that parking fees may apply. Make sure to check for any additional costs.

  • Public Transportation

    If you prefer public transportation, start by taking a bus from Kawaguchiko Station. Board the Fujikyu bus bound for Yamanakako and get off at the Yamanakako Onsen bus stop. The ride will take about 30 minutes. From there, you will need to walk approximately 15 minutes to Hana-no-miyako Park Furara. The park is located at 〒401-0501 Yamanashi, Minamitsuru District, Yamanakako, Yamanaka, 1650. Bus fares may vary, so be prepared to pay for your ticket at the station.

Discover more about Hana-no-miyako Park Furara

Hana-no-miyako Park Furara, located in the scenic Yamanashi Prefecture, is a haven for nature enthusiasts and tourists seeking a peaceful retreat. Spanning lush, landscaped gardens adorned with seasonal flowers, this park offers an immersive experience into Japan's natural beauty. Visitors can stroll along well-maintained pathways that weave through colorful flower beds, providing ample opportunities for photography and leisurely walks. The park is particularly known for its breathtaking seasonal flower displays, including cherry blossoms in spring and vibrant foliage in autumn, creating a picturesque backdrop for visitors year-round. In addition to its stunning gardens, Hana-no-miyako Park Furara is equipped with various amenities, including rest areas, picnic spots, and information centers, ensuring a comfortable visit for families and solo travelers alike. The park also features designated areas for recreational activities, making it an ideal place for both relaxation and fun. The panoramic views of the surrounding mountains enrich the experience, inviting guests to take a moment to appreciate the serene atmosphere.
